ديف أوبس

سحر البيانات: فن استخدام أمر tar في Linux

في لحظة هدوء تعتلي السماء، يتسامر الكود الرقمي مع لغة الحواس اللامادية في عالم لا يعرف الحدود، حيث يستدعي الفضولنا الأنيق لاستكشاف أغوار تكنولوجيا المعلومات. إن فك ضغط ملفات tar.gz على نظام Linux يشكل رحلة مثيرة في عالم الأوامر الطويلة والتحكم الساحر بالبيانات المضغوطة.

عندما يتعلق الأمر بملفات tar.gz، يأتي أمامنا أمر “tar” كبطل ينقذنا من لغز الضغط. يكفي إدراك أن هذا الأمر يعمل كأداة سحرية، تمكننا من إلقاء نظرة في عمق الملفات المعبأة بإحكام، وكأنه يفتح بابًا إلى عالم آخر.

لنبدأ هذه الرحلة بالأوامر البسيطة، حيث يمكننا استخدام “tar” لفحص محتوى ملف مضغوط. يكفي أن تقوم بكتابة الأمر:

bash
tar -tf file.tar.gz

هنا، يفتح السحر الأسود أمامنا، ونجد أنفسنا وقد تمكنا من استعراض الملفات داخل الضغط، كما لو أننا نلقي نظرة على متحف من الأشياء الثمينة.

ولكن السحر لا يتوقف هنا، بل يتجه إلى العمق، حيث يمكننا استخدام “tar” لاستخراج المحتوى بكل بساطة. كتب الأمر التالي يقوم بهضم الملفات واستخراجها إلى المجلد الحالي:

bash
tar -xf file.tar.gz

الآن، كأننا نفك قيودًا، يظهر المحتوى بكل روعة، كأنه ألوان تتساقط من لوحة فنية.

ولكن هل يكفي أن نكتفي بفحص الملفات؟ بالطبع لا! يمكننا تحديد مجلد معين لاستخراج المحتوى إليه، كما لو أننا نزرع بذور جديدة في حقل غني بالبيانات:

bash
tar -xf file.tar.gz -C /path/to/destination

هنا، يُفَجِّر الأمر تلك البذور في المجلد المحدد، وينمو الشجر البرمجي بكل روعة.

في الختام، يظهر لنا أن استخدام أمر “tar” في فك ضغط ملفات tar.gz ليس مجرد إجراء فني، بل رحلة فضولية تأخذنا إلى أبعاد جديدة من الفهم والتحكم في عالم البيانات المضغوطة، حيث يتحقق السحر بين أوامر Linux وروح المغامرة التقنية.

المزيد من المعلومات

وكأننا نتسلق قمة الجبل، دعنا نزيد ارتفاعًا في هذه الرحلة الساحرة لاستكشاف المزيد من أسرار أمر “tar” وعالم الضغط والفك.

لا يقتصر فحص ملفات tar.gz على مجرد رؤية المحتوى، بل يتيح لنا “tar” أيضًا القدرة على إضافة بعض اللمسات الفنية. يمكننا على سبيل المثال ضغط ملفات بتقنية gzip مع “tar” مباشرة، مما يوفر لنا تركيبة فعّالة لتقليص حجم الملفات:

bash
tar -czf compressed_file.tar.gz files_to_compress/

هنا، يدمج “tar” مع gzip لخلق قوة ضغط تتيح لنا تقديم ملف ضغط في سحر واحد، حيث يتلاقى الألوان لتخلق تأثيرًا بصريًا رائعًا.

وفي عالم الحماية، يأتي “tar” بخيار لتشفير المحتوى أثناء الضغط، وهو ما يضيف للحماية طبقة إضافية من السحر الرقمي. باستخدام OpenSSL، يمكننا تحقيق هذا السحر عبر أمر مثل:

bash
tar --create --file=- files_to_encrypt/ | openssl enc -aes-256-cbc -out encrypted_file.tar.gz

هنا، يتم إنشاء ملف مضغوط ومشفر في سلسلة من الأوامر الرمزية، مما يجسد القوة الساحرة في تأمين البيانات.

ولكن هل يكون السحر مكتملًا دون إمكانية استعادة الزمن؟ يأتي “tar” مع القدرة على حفظ الطابع الزمني للملفات أثناء الفحص والاستخراج، وهو ما يعزز فعالية الإدارة. يمكننا تحقيق ذلك عبر إضافة خيار “-v” للأمر:

bash
tar -xvf file.tar.gz

هنا، يظهر لنا الزمن بكل ألوانه، حيث يعيد “tar” بناء الزمن بكل تفاصيله.

في ختام هذه الرحلة، نجد أن استخدام أمر “tar” في لينكس لفحص وفك ضغط ملفات tar.gz ليس مجرد عمل فني بل رحلة إبداعية تكشف لنا عن القوة الساحرة في تحكمنا بالبيانات وإدارتها، حيث يرتقي الأمر إلى مستوى الفن في تلاعبه بالأوقات والمساحات ببراعة تامة.

الخلاصة

وفي نهاية هذه الرحلة الفنية في عالم “tar” على نظام Linux، نكتشف أن هذا الأمر ليس مجرد سلسلة من الأوامر البسيطة، بل هو سحر يتجلى في تحكمنا بأروقة البيانات المضغوطة. إن استخدام “tar” لفحص وفك ضغط ملفات tar.gz يمثل فنًا يجمع بين الدقة والإبداع في تشكيل البيانات.

من خلال سحر “tar”، تعلمنا كيف نستكشف البيانات المضغوطة، وكيف نقودها إلى عوالم جديدة باستخدام الأوامر السحرية. من فحص المحتوى إلى ضغط الملفات ببراعة، ومن حماية البيانات بالتشفير إلى الاحتفاظ بالزمن، كانت هذه الرحلة رحيقًا تقنيًا يفوح برائحة الإلمام والإتقان.

وكما ينتهي الفنان عندما يضع اللمسات الأخيرة على لوحته، نختم هذه الخوض في عالم “tar” بختام يحمل في طياته تراثًا تقنيًا، وذكريات تستحضر اللحظات التي انغمست فيها أمر Linux بأوامره السحرية. إن استخدام “tar” يعزز فهمنا ويثري تجربتنا في عالم الحوسبة، حيث يكمن الجمال في القدرة على فهم والإتقان.

زر الذهاب إلى الأعلى